Career
Pavón started his career at hometown club Victoria and then played alongside compatriots Walter Nahún López, Reynaldo Clavasquín and Juan Manuel Cárcamo for BSV Bad Bleiberg in the Austrian Football First League. He returned to Honduras after three seasons in Austria in 2002 to play for Motagua, Platense and Vida. Pavón joined Xelajú of the Liga Nacional de Guatemala in July 2008, after spending the 2007-2008 season with Turkish amateur club Eğirdir Belediye Spor but returned to Vida in 2009.
He retired in summer 2012 but was lured to playing again by Real Sociedad.
Pavón made his debut for Honduras in a November 1999 friendly match against Trinidad & Tobago and has earned a total of 17 caps, scoring 1 goal. He also played at the 2003 UNCAF Nations Cup as well as at the 2000 CONCACAF Gold Cup.
His final international was a February 2003 UNCAF Nations Cup match against Paraguay.
